Home
last modified time | relevance | path

Searched refs:reducer (Results 1 - 25 of 37) sorted by relevance

12

/third_party/skia/third_party/externals/spirv-tools/test/reduce/
H A Dvalidation_during_reduction_test.cpp15 #include "source/reduce/reducer.h"
30 // the resulting module invalid. We use this to test the reducer's behavior in
119 // MakeModuleInvalidPass will make the module invalid. Check that the reducer in TEST()
212 Reducer reducer(env); in TEST()
213 reducer.SetMessageConsumer(NopDiagnostic); in TEST()
216 reducer.SetInterestingnessFunction( in TEST()
219 reducer.AddReductionPass( in TEST()
233 Reducer::ReductionResultStatus status = reducer.Run( in TEST()
238 // The reducer should have no impact. in TEST()
427 Reducer reducer(en in TEST()
458 SetupReducerForCheckValidationOptions(Reducer* reducer) SetupReducerForCheckValidationOptions() argument
[all...]
H A Dreducer_test.cpp15 #include "source/reduce/reducer.h"
194 Reducer reducer(kEnv); in TEST()
196 reducer.SetMessageConsumer(kMessageConsumer); in TEST()
197 reducer.SetInterestingnessFunction( in TEST()
201 reducer.AddReductionPass( in TEST()
203 reducer.AddReductionPass( in TEST()
216 Reducer::ReductionResultStatus status = reducer.Run( in TEST()
514 Reducer reducer(kEnv); in TEST()
516 reducer.SetInterestingnessFunction(InterestingWhileIMulReachable); in TEST()
517 reducer in TEST()
[all...]
/third_party/skia/third_party/externals/swiftshader/third_party/SPIRV-Tools/test/reduce/
H A Dvalidation_during_reduction_test.cpp15 #include "source/reduce/reducer.h"
30 // the resulting module invalid. We use this to test the reducer's behavior in
119 // MakeModuleInvalidPass will make the module invalid. Check that the reducer in TEST()
212 Reducer reducer(env); in TEST()
213 reducer.SetMessageConsumer(NopDiagnostic); in TEST()
216 reducer.SetInterestingnessFunction( in TEST()
219 reducer.AddReductionPass( in TEST()
233 Reducer::ReductionResultStatus status = reducer.Run( in TEST()
238 // The reducer should have no impact. in TEST()
427 Reducer reducer(en in TEST()
458 SetupReducerForCheckValidationOptions(Reducer* reducer) SetupReducerForCheckValidationOptions() argument
[all...]
H A Dreducer_test.cpp15 #include "source/reduce/reducer.h"
194 Reducer reducer(kEnv); in TEST()
196 reducer.SetMessageConsumer(kMessageConsumer); in TEST()
197 reducer.SetInterestingnessFunction( in TEST()
201 reducer.AddReductionPass( in TEST()
203 reducer.AddReductionPass( in TEST()
216 Reducer::ReductionResultStatus status = reducer.Run( in TEST()
514 Reducer reducer(kEnv); in TEST()
516 reducer.SetInterestingnessFunction(InterestingWhileIMulReachable); in TEST()
517 reducer in TEST()
[all...]
/third_party/spirv-tools/test/reduce/
H A Dvalidation_during_reduction_test.cpp15 #include "source/reduce/reducer.h"
30 // the resulting module invalid. We use this to test the reducer's behavior in
119 // MakeModuleInvalidPass will make the module invalid. Check that the reducer in TEST()
212 Reducer reducer(env); in TEST()
213 reducer.SetMessageConsumer(NopDiagnostic); in TEST()
216 reducer.SetInterestingnessFunction( in TEST()
219 reducer.AddReductionPass( in TEST()
233 Reducer::ReductionResultStatus status = reducer.Run( in TEST()
238 // The reducer should have no impact. in TEST()
427 Reducer reducer(en in TEST()
458 SetupReducerForCheckValidationOptions(Reducer* reducer) SetupReducerForCheckValidationOptions() argument
[all...]
H A Dreducer_test.cpp15 #include "source/reduce/reducer.h"
194 Reducer reducer(kEnv); in TEST()
196 reducer.SetMessageConsumer(kMessageConsumer); in TEST()
197 reducer.SetInterestingnessFunction( in TEST()
201 reducer.AddReductionPass( in TEST()
203 reducer.AddReductionPass( in TEST()
216 Reducer::ReductionResultStatus status = reducer.Run( in TEST()
514 Reducer reducer(kEnv); in TEST()
516 reducer.SetInterestingnessFunction(InterestingWhileIMulReachable); in TEST()
517 reducer in TEST()
[all...]
/third_party/skia/tests/
H A DPathOpsCubicReduceOrderTest.cpp65 SkReduceOrder reducer; in DEF_TEST() local
114 order = reducer.reduce(cubic, SkReduceOrder::kAllow_Quadratics); in DEF_TEST()
125 order = reducer.reduce(cubic, SkReduceOrder::kAllow_Quadratics); in DEF_TEST()
128 order = reducer.reduce(cubic, SkReduceOrder::kAllow_Quadratics); in DEF_TEST()
137 order = reducer.reduce(cubic, SkReduceOrder::kAllow_Quadratics); in DEF_TEST()
148 order = reducer.reduce(cubic, SkReduceOrder::kAllow_Quadratics); in DEF_TEST()
159 order = reducer.reduce(cubic, SkReduceOrder::kAllow_Quadratics); in DEF_TEST()
170 order = reducer.reduce(cubic, SkReduceOrder::kAllow_Quadratics); in DEF_TEST()
173 order = reducer.reduce(cubic, SkReduceOrder::kAllow_Quadratics); in DEF_TEST()
182 order = reducer in DEF_TEST()
[all...]
H A DPathOpsQuadReduceOrderTest.cpp25 SkReduceOrder reducer; in oneOffTest() local
26 SkDEBUGCODE(int result = ) reducer.reduce(quad); in oneOffTest()
33 SkReduceOrder reducer; in standardTestCases() local
55 order = reducer.reduce(quad); in standardTestCases()
64 order = reducer.reduce(quad); in standardTestCases()
H A DPathOpsTestCommon.cpp68 SkReduceOrder reducer; in toQuadraticTs() local
69 int order = reducer.reduce(*cubic, SkReduceOrder::kAllow_Quadratics); in toQuadraticTs()
103 int orderP1 = reducer.reduce(pair.first(), SkReduceOrder::kNo_Quadratics); in toQuadraticTs()
107 int orderP2 = reducer.reduce(pair.second(), SkReduceOrder::kNo_Quadratics); in toQuadraticTs()
H A DPathOpsQuadLineIntersectionThreadedTest.cpp91 SkReduceOrder reducer; in testQuadLineIntersectMain() local
92 int order = reducer.reduce(quad); in testQuadLineIntersectMain()
/third_party/typescript/tests/baselines/reference/
H A DtypeGuardOfFormTypeOfFunction.js77 function configureStore<S extends object>(reducer: (() => void) | Record<keyof S, () => void>) {
79 if (typeof reducer === 'function') {
80 rootReducer = reducer;
154 function configureStore(reducer) {
156 if (typeof reducer === 'function') {
157 rootReducer = reducer;
H A DrecursiveArrayNotCircular.js21 function reducer(action: ReducerAction): void {
33 action.payload.map(reducer);
50 function reducer(action) { function
62 action.payload.map(reducer);
H A DbluebirdStaticThis.js90 static reduce<R, U>(dit: typeof Promise, values: Promise.Thenable<Promise.Thenable<R>[]>, reducer: (total: U, current: R, index: number, arrayLength: number) => Promise.Thenable<U>, initialValue?: U): Promise<U>;
91 static reduce<R, U>(dit: typeof Promise, values: Promise.Thenable<Promise.Thenable<R>[]>, reducer: (total: U, current: R, index: number, arrayLength: number) => U, initialValue?: U): Promise<U>;
93 static reduce<R, U>(dit: typeof Promise, values: Promise.Thenable<R[]>, reducer: (total: U, current: R, index: number, arrayLength: number) => Promise.Thenable<U>, initialValue?: U): Promise<U>;
94 static reduce<R, U>(dit: typeof Promise, values: Promise.Thenable<R[]>, reducer: (total: U, current: R, index: number, arrayLength: number) => U, initialValue?: U): Promise<U>;
96 static reduce<R, U>(dit: typeof Promise, values: Promise.Thenable<R>[], reducer: (total: U, current: R, index: number, arrayLength: number) => Promise.Thenable<U>, initialValue?: U): Promise<U>;
97 static reduce<R, U>(dit: typeof Promise, values: Promise.Thenable<R>[], reducer: (total: U, current: R, index: number, arrayLength: number) => U, initialValue?: U): Promise<U>;
99 static reduce<R, U>(dit: typeof Promise, values: R[], reducer: (total: U, current: R, index: number, arrayLength: number) => Promise.Thenable<U>, initialValue?: U): Promise<U>;
100 static reduce<R, U>(dit: typeof Promise, values: R[], reducer: (total: U, current: R, index: number, arrayLength: number) => U, initialValue?: U): Promise<U>;
H A DdependentDestructuredVariables.js235 const reducer: (...args: ReducerArgs) => void = (op, args) => {
246 reducer("add", { a: 1, b: 3 });
247 reducer("concat", { firstArr: [1, 2], secondArr: [3, 4] });
585 const reducer = (op, args) => {
595 reducer("add", { a: 1, b: 3 });
596 reducer("concat", { firstArr: [1, 2], secondArr: [3, 4] });
766 declare const reducer: (...args: ReducerArgs) => void;
/third_party/skia/third_party/externals/spirv-tools/source/fuzz/
H A Dadded_function_reducer.cpp22 #include "source/reduce/reducer.h"
61 reduce::Reducer reducer(target_env_); in Run()
62 reducer.SetMessageConsumer(consumer_); in Run()
63 reducer.AddDefaultReductionPasses(); in Run()
64 reducer.SetInterestingnessFunction( in Run()
80 "The added function reducer should not have been invoked."); in Run()
87 reducer.Run(std::move(binary_to_reduce), &reduced_binary, reducer_options, in Run()
/third_party/skia/third_party/externals/swiftshader/third_party/SPIRV-Tools/source/fuzz/
H A Dadded_function_reducer.cpp22 #include "source/reduce/reducer.h"
61 reduce::Reducer reducer(target_env_); in Run()
62 reducer.SetMessageConsumer(consumer_); in Run()
63 reducer.AddDefaultReductionPasses(); in Run()
64 reducer.SetInterestingnessFunction( in Run()
80 "The added function reducer should not have been invoked."); in Run()
87 reducer.Run(std::move(binary_to_reduce), &reduced_binary, reducer_options, in Run()
/third_party/spirv-tools/source/fuzz/
H A Dadded_function_reducer.cpp22 #include "source/reduce/reducer.h"
61 reduce::Reducer reducer(target_env_); in Run()
62 reducer.SetMessageConsumer(consumer_); in Run()
63 reducer.AddDefaultReductionPasses(); in Run()
64 reducer.SetInterestingnessFunction( in Run()
80 "The added function reducer should not have been invoked."); in Run()
87 reducer.Run(std::move(binary_to_reduce), &reduced_binary, reducer_options, in Run()
/third_party/skia/src/pathops/
H A DSkReduceOrder.cpp249 SkReduceOrder reducer; in Quad() local
250 int order = reducer.reduce(quad); in Quad()
253 *reducePts++ = reducer.fLine[index].asSkPoint(); in Quad()
275 SkReduceOrder reducer; in Cubic() local
276 int order = reducer.reduce(cubic, kAllow_Quadratics); in Cubic()
279 *reducePts++ = reducer.fQuad[index].asSkPoint(); in Cubic()
/third_party/skia/third_party/externals/spirv-tools/tools/reduce/
H A Dreduce.cpp24 #include "source/reduce/reducer.h"
89 * The reducer does not place a time limit on how long the interestingness test in PrintUsage()
94 NOTE: The reducer is a work in progress. in PrintUsage()
105 reducer will take before giving up. in PrintUsage()
108 input module. The reducer will restrict attention to this in PrintUsage()
121 Display reducer version information. in PrintUsage()
291 spvtools::reduce::Reducer reducer(target_env); in main()
300 reducer.SetInterestingnessFunction( in main()
316 reducer.AddDefaultReductionPasses(); in main()
318 reducer in main()
[all...]
/third_party/skia/third_party/externals/swiftshader/third_party/SPIRV-Tools/tools/reduce/
H A Dreduce.cpp24 #include "source/reduce/reducer.h"
89 * The reducer does not place a time limit on how long the interestingness test in PrintUsage()
94 NOTE: The reducer is a work in progress. in PrintUsage()
105 reducer will take before giving up. in PrintUsage()
108 input module. The reducer will restrict attention to this in PrintUsage()
121 Display reducer version information. in PrintUsage()
291 spvtools::reduce::Reducer reducer(target_env); in main()
300 reducer.SetInterestingnessFunction( in main()
316 reducer.AddDefaultReductionPasses(); in main()
318 reducer in main()
[all...]
/third_party/spirv-tools/tools/reduce/
H A Dreduce.cpp25 #include "source/reduce/reducer.h"
84 * The reducer does not place a time limit on how long the interestingness test in PrintUsage()
89 NOTE: The reducer is a work in progress. in PrintUsage()
100 reducer will take before giving up. in PrintUsage()
103 input module. The reducer will restrict attention to this in PrintUsage()
116 Display reducer version information. in PrintUsage()
280 spvtools::reduce::Reducer reducer(target_env); in main()
289 reducer.SetInterestingnessFunction( in main()
305 reducer.AddDefaultReductionPasses(); in main()
307 reducer in main()
[all...]
/third_party/node/lib/internal/streams/
H A Doperators.js299 async function reduce(reducer, initialValue, options) {
300 if (typeof reducer !== 'function') {
302 'reducer', ['Function', 'AsyncFunction'], reducer);
335 initialValue = await reducer(initialValue, value, { signal });
/third_party/node/deps/v8/src/compiler/
H A Dgraph-reducer.cc5 #include "src/compiler/graph-reducer.h"
62 void GraphReducer::AddReducer(Reducer* reducer) { in AddReducer() argument
63 reducers_.push_back(reducer); in AddReducer()
86 for (Reducer* const reducer : reducers_) reducer->Finalize(); in ReduceNode()
107 // No change from this reducer. in Reduce()
117 StdoutStream{} << "- In-place update of #" << *node << " by reducer " in Reduce()
131 << *(reduction.replacement()) << " by reducer " in Reduce()
140 // No change from any reducer. in Reduce()
143 // At least one reducer di in Reduce()
[all...]
/third_party/skia/third_party/externals/angle2/src/compiler/translator/TranslatorMetalDirect/
H A DReduceInterfaceBlocks.cpp121 Reducer reducer(compiler, idGen); in ReduceInterfaceBlocks()
122 if (!reducer.rebuildRoot(root)) in ReduceInterfaceBlocks()
/third_party/python/Lib/multiprocessing/
H A Dcontext.py204 def reducer(self): member in BaseContext
209 @reducer.setter
210 def reducer(self, reduction): member in BaseContext

Completed in 14 milliseconds

12